Tools & Materials
- Scissors or Cutting Machine
- Text Weight Metallic Paper in Onyx (1 piece per lantern, 2 pieces for the large bat)
- Vellum Paper (1 piece Kiwi Green, 2 pieces Royal Purple, 1 piece Yellow Gold)
- Tombow – Permanent Adhesive Tape
- Lia Griffith Vellum Paper Pack
Steps
- Gather the tools and materials listed above.
- Cut the paper according to the pattern notes.
- Using the glue dots, glue the vellum onto the back side of the corresponding lantern.
- Place glue on the tab to glue the lantern into shape.
- Using the tabs, glue the top onto the lantern.
- Glue on the accessories (i.e. bat wings and Frankenstein’s head bolts).
